Output 03af659019628e96e8818c9d85e1008a94a4d61fe00727b9245a222ee2805698:1

value
13089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e23311121675ebf9294cb7038334aefac73b5d OP_EQUAL
address
3HMrSxkmWegthxWhB67ASArtakQyachV13
transaction
03af659019628e96e8818c9d85e1008a94a4d61fe00727b9245a222ee2805698
spent
true